---The point is that we ALL have something we would rather not have. We are all saddled with something that we are dealing with. I have heard it being called ‘’one’s cross to bear,’’ among other things.
---Whatever we call it, there is a time that we go through being very sure that without this ‘’THING’’ we would do a whole lot better. I know that I went through this with my hand. I was really convinced that without my hand I’d be ‘’something else.’’ Take that any way you want.
---I would like to point out the fantasy in this. The fantasy is this - I thought that I would be better NOT having this defect, when ALL THE TIME it contained all I would ever need to live and live affectively. The very thing I was trying to avoid…contained the very things I was looking for. That is, usually, the case.
---And, just to bring it to a reality - the learning is in how to deal with being born like this and living with my hand as it is. Society is saying that life is another way then you obviously are. We all have something that falls into this category and ‘’we would rather not have - that is, UNTIL WE LEARN TO HAVE IT.’’
---We learn to incorporate ourselves into the land of the living, but are now very equipped to do battle on many fields that others can still find tentative. I, guess, that it is my way of saying ‘’whatever doesn’t kill you, serves to make you stronger.’’
